Family/Internal Medicine Opportunity in Coastal Oregon

Join a respected, physician-led group that has been a cornerstone of care in its community for nearly 70 years. This outpatient-only Family or Internal Medicine role offers autonomy, partner track, and the ability to shape your own clinical interests. Located in a scenic coastal town, this opportunity provides work-life balance and a supportive, collegial environment.


Practice Overview

  • You'll join a physician-owned multispecialty group with 16 providers including IM, OB/GYN, Pediatrics, Behavioral Health, and Allergy
  • 100% outpatient with a patient mix of 60% adult, 40% geriatric; no hospital responsibilities
  • Shared outpatient-only call with triage nurse screening; minimal physician involvement
  • Procedures based on your interest (e.g., joint injections, dermatology, women's health, EKGs)


Schedule

  • 4-day workweek (Monday, Tuesday, Thursday, Friday), 8 AM - 5 PM
  • No inpatient responsibilities; practice at the top of your license
  • Average 16-22 patients per day with flexibility to develop niche areas of focus
  • Outpatient call only, shared among group, with rare after-hours needs


Compensation & Benefits

  • Base salary (negotiable) with production bonuses and partnership track
  • Partner buy-in after 2 years; partner earnings $500K+
  • Signing bonus; relocation, loan repayment of $75,000 for 2 year contract
  • 20 days PTO (4-day workweek) , $3,000 CME, full benefits (health, dental, vision, retirement, malpractice)


Candidate Requirements

  • Board-certified or board-eligible in Family Medicine or Internal Medicine
  • Eligible for Oregon licensure
  • Strong communication and clinical skills
  • Comfortable managing adult and geriatric populations in a full-spectrum outpatient setting
